CVE-2026-13534: Authorization Bypass in CherryHQ cherry-studio
CVE-2026-13534 is an authorization bypass vulnerability in CherryHQ cherry-studio versions 1.9.0 through 1.9.7. It affects the sha256 function in the MemoryService component of the CherryIN Preload API. The vulnerability allows remote attackers to manipulate the argument state to bypass authorization. Exploitation complexity is high, and the exploit is publicly known. The vendor plans to remove the affected memory component in version 2.0.

Technical Summary
This vulnerability in CherryHQ cherry-studio up to version 1.9.7 involves the sha256 function in src/main/services/memory/MemoryService.ts within the CherryIN Preload API. By manipulating the argument state, an attacker can bypass authorization controls remotely. The attack complexity is high, indicating difficulty in exploitation. Although an exploit is publicly available, the CVSS 4.0 base score is low (2.3), reflecting limited impact and exploitability. The vendor has indicated that the affected memory component will be removed in the upcoming version 2.0, but no official patch or fix is currently available.
Potential Impact
Successful exploitation allows an attacker with low privileges to bypass authorization mechanisms remotely, potentially gaining unauthorized access to restricted functions or data within cherry-studio. However, the attack complexity is high and the overall severity is low, limiting the practical impact. There are no known exploits in the wild at this time.
Mitigation Recommendations
No official patch or fix is currently available for this vulnerability. The vendor plans to remove the affected memory component in version 2.0, which will mitigate this issue. Until then, users should consider the risk low but remain cautious. Monitor vendor communications for updates or patches. No immediate action is mandated by the vendor.
